The History of Freemasonry And Its Origins
Freemasonry has a rich and mystical history that stretches back centuries. Its origins can be traced to the medieval stonemasons guilds that operated in Europe throughout the construction of cathedrals. These guilds, called operative lodges, had stringent regulations and practices to guarantee the high quality of their workmanship.
As societal modifications occurred, these guilds started accepting non-masons as members, triggering speculative lodges, such as Settle Masonic Lodge.
The values of Freemasonry, such as brotherly love, truth and charity, were embedded into its foundation and have stayed true throughout its history. Over time, Freemasonry spread out globally and evolved into a vast network of Masonic Lodges, such as Settle Masonic Lodge, that continue to maintain these principles while adjusting to modern times.

Indicating behind typical symbols used at Settle Masonic Lodge. The symbols utilized at Settle Masonic Lodge hold deep significance and convey important principles to their members. One such sign is the square and compasses, representing morality and virtue. The square symbolizes sincerity and fairness in all negotiations, while the compasses remind Masons at Settle to keep their desires and enthusiasms within due bounds. Together, they work as a constant suggestion for members to lead upright lives.
Another common symbol in Settle Masonic Lodge is the pillars, generally illustrated as 2 columns, representing wisdom, strength, and appeal. These pillars are reminders for Masons to seek knowledge, empower themselves with self-control, and appreciate the charm that exists on the planet.
The apron worn by Masons at Settle are likewise a significant symbol. It represents the purity of heart and commitment to the craft. It works as a visual suggestion of the Masonic values of humbleness, stability, and commitment to self-improvement.

Significance of Settle Masonic Lodge architecture and design
The architecture and layout of Settle Masonic Lodge are rich with symbolism, reflecting the concepts and worths of Freemasonry. One crucial aspect is the orientation of the lodge, usually facing east. This direction represents the dawn of knowledge and clean slates, representing the constant pursuit of knowledge and spiritual development.
The lodge room itself is embellished with different signs, such as the altar, which acts as the center of focus during ceremonies and represents a devotion to moral and spiritual mentors. The pillars at the entryway, frequently imitated those in King Solomon’s Temple, represent strength and knowledge.
The plan of seating within the lodge room also brings meaning. The Junior Warden’s chair is positioned in the south to represent the heat of passion and vibrant energy, while the Senior Warden’s chair is in the west to represent maturity and reflection. The Master’s chair, situated in the east, symbolizes management and knowledge.
These architectural components and their positioning communicate crucial lessons to Masons at Settle during their ritual and given meetings, reminding them of their commitment to look for knowledge, establish strong character, and nurture their spiritual development.
